Discover Malaysia in 4 Days

Day 1: Explore Kuala Lumpur
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ia
8:00 AM
Visit Petronas Twin Towers
Start your day with a visit to the iconic Petronas Twin Towers, an architectural marvel offering panoramic views of the city skyline.
It's a 15-minute drive from the city center. You can take a taxi or use ride-hailing apps like Grab.
40 MYR, 2 hours
11:00 AM
Explore Batu Caves
Head to Batu Caves, a sacred Hindu site with a massive golden statue and a series of caves and cave temples to explore.
Take a 30-minute train ride from KL Sentral Station to Batu Caves Station.
Free entry (small fee for cave temples visit), 3 hours
3:00 PM
Shop at Central Market
Indulge in some shopping at Central Market, a cultural hub offering a variety of local handicrafts, art, and souvenirs.
It's a 10-minute walk from Pasar Seni LRT Station.
Varies based on purchases, 2 hours
6:00 PM
Dinner at Jalan Alor
End your day with a delicious dinner at Jalan Alor, known for its bustling street food stalls offering a variety of local delicacies.
Take a short taxi ride or walk from Central Market.
30-50 MYR, 1.5 hours

Day 2: More of Kuala Lumpur
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ia
9:00 AM
Visit KL Bird Park
Spend the morning at KL Bird Park, the world's largest free-flight walk-in aviary, home to various bird species in a lush tropical setting.
A 20-minute drive from the city center. You can take a taxi or use ride-hailing apps like Grab.
70 MYR, 2 hours
12:00 PM
Lunch at Heli Lounge Bar
Enjoy a unique dining experience at Heli Lounge Bar, a helicopter pad turned rooftop bar offering panoramic views of the city.
Approximately 15 minutes drive from KL Bird Park.
100-150 MYR, 2 hours
3:00 PM
Explore Bukit Bintang
Discover the vibrant shopping and entertainment district of Bukit Bintang, known for its luxury malls, street markets, and food options.
A short taxi ride or walk from Heli Lounge Bar.
Varies based on purchases, 3 hours
7:00 PM
Dinner at Atmosphere 360
Indulge in a fine dining experience at Atmosphere 360, a revolving restaurant atop the KL Tower offering breathtaking city views.
Around 10 minutes drive from Bukit Bintang.
250-300 MYR, 2 hours

Day 3: Discover Penang
Penang, Malaysia
9:00 AM
Visit Penang Hill
Start your day by taking a funicular train ride up Penang Hill for panoramic views of the island and exploring attractions like The Habitat.
A short drive from George Town or you can take a Grab.
30 MYR, 3 hours
12:00 PM
Lunch at Gurney Drive Hawker Centre
Enjoy a variety of delicious local street food at Gurney Drive Hawker Centre, a popular food destination in Penang.
Approximately 30 minutes drive from Penang Hill.
20-40 MYR, 2 hours
3:00 PM
Explore George Town Street Art
Stroll through the charming streets of George Town to admire its famous street art murals and vibrant cultural heritage.
You can walk or take a short taxi ride to George Town.
Free, 2 hours
6:00 PM
Dinner at Tek Sen Restaurant
Treat yourself to a sumptuous dinner at Tek Sen Restaurant, known for its authentic Chinese cuisine and cozy ambiance.
Located in George Town, easily accessible by taxi or on foot.
50-80 MYR, 1.5 hours

Day 4: Experience Malacca
Malacca, Malaysia
9:00 AM
Visit A Famosa Fort
Begin your day by exploring A Famosa Fort, a well-preserved Portuguese fortress and an iconic historical site in Malacca.
A short walk or taxi ride from the city center.
Free, 2 hours
11:00 AM
Explore Jonker Street
Immerse yourself in the vibrant culture of Malacca by wandering through Jonker Street, famous for its antique shops, street food, and local souvenirs.
Jonker Street is within walking distance from A Famosa Fort.
Varies based on purchases, 2 hours
1:00 PM
Lunch at Nancy's Kitchen
Savor authentic Nyonya cuisine at Nancy's Kitchen, a popular restaurant in Malacca known for its delicious traditional dishes.
Located near Jonker Street, a short walk from the fort.
40-60 MYR, 1.5 hours
3:00 PM
Visit St. Paul's Hill
Climb up St. Paul's Hill to explore the historic ruins of St. Paul's Church and enjoy panoramic views of Malacca from the hilltop.
A short walk from Jonker Street and Nancy's Kitchen.
Free, 1.5 hours
